Abstract

A suction muffler receives low-temperature refrigerant gas discharged into a hermetic container from a suction pipe by a gas catcher, and feeds the gas to a compressor. The lower end of an opening of the gas catcher is located at a position lower than the lower end of an orifice of the suction pipe so as to catch the refrigerant gas falling obliquely downward inside the hermetic container.

Claims (17)

1. A compressor comprising:

a compression element for compressing refrigerant gas;

a hermetic container for accommodating the compression element; and

a suction pipe linking inside and outside the hermetic container,

wherein the compression element comprises:

a cylinder;

a piston which reciprocates inside the cylinder;

a compression chamber formed in the cylinder; and

a suction muffler whose one end leads to the compression chamber, the suction muffler comprising:

a main body forming a muffling space;

an intake port opened to the hermetic container and leading to the muffling space; and

a gas catcher surrounding the intake port and having an opening facing an orifice of the suction pipe,

wherein the opening of the gas catcher has an upper end located above a lower end of the orifice of the suction pipe and a lower end located below the lower end of the orifice of the suction pipe, the lower end of the opening of the gas catcher defined by a lower surface of the gas catcher, and

the intake port has an opening facing the lower surface of the gas catcher,

wherein an angle between a horizontal line and a shortest line connecting the lower end of the opening of the gas catcher and the lower end of the orifice of the suction pipe is not less than 30°, and

wherein the intake port of the suction muffler is opened downward, and an inner face of the gas catcher is concavely curved.

2. The compressor as defined in claim 1 , wherein a volume of the gas catcher is not less than 40% of a volume of the compression chamber.
